摘要
Our paper empirically explores the relationship between the ratio of government debt to Gross Domestic Product (GDP) and the per capita GDP growth rate for a sample of 10 former Communist countries, currently members of the EU 27, for the 1999-2010 period. The results show a statistically significant non-linear relationship between the government debt to GDP ratio and the per capita GDP growth rate for all the analyzed countries. We have found that the government debt turning point is around 50%. If the government debt to GDP ratio exceeds this level, it could generate a negative impact on the GDP growth rate. The 95% confidence intervals for the debt turning point start as low as 40% of GDP, which calls for more prudent government debt policies.
